Moving questions, answered by experts

Most hardware stores or shipping centers have mirror boxes and moving supplies. You can find most of what you need online, but if you’re still having trouble, contact your movers or moving truck rental company. They may sell boxes and packing supplies, too.

Knowing how much a typical long-distance move will cost is the first step in the budgeting process. Start by calling at least three local moving companies for quotes so you have a ballpark range—then you can start saving weekly. You can also start decluttering your home to reduce your truck weight and try to find donated packing supplies from local businesses or neighbors that recently moved. 

To save your flooring’s finish and to protect yourself from injury, use furniture sliders to move your couch from room to room on the same house level. Double-check that entryways are large enough to pass through. If you need to move a couch up or down stairs, hire a team of movers to help you with this task to avoid damaging your walls or staircase.

According to the U.S. Department of Housing and Urban Development, mobile homes built before 1976 do not meet the current safety standards and shouldn’t be moved even a short distance.

Never attempt to move a partially-filled tank, especially with the fish still in it. Even a minor alteration or adjustment in your movement can cause the water to move, disrupting the balance and potentially causing you to drop the tank or strain your back to prevent it from falling. However, you should maintain enough water on the bottom to keep the substrate slightly submerged during transit.
